I am plotting a map using px.scatter_geo and a column with ISO-3 codes is selected for the ālocationsā argument. The resulting map, however, does not show bubble for Singapore whose ISO-3 code is āSGPā as correctly filled in the data file. What have I missed? Thanks.
Hi @sparkling,
You need to update the āresolutionā of your figure in order to include smaller regions like Singapore. A resolution of 50
will be enough to include that region. With px.scatter_geo
, you can do this using the update layout method.
For example:
worldfig = px.scatter_geo(
gapminder,
locations="iso_alpha",
size="pop", # size of markers, "pop" is one of the columns of gapminder
)
worldfig.update_layout({
'geo': {
'resolution': 50
}
})
